Dispute Prevention & Transparency in Agarwood Trade

Ensuring Trust from Plantation to Market


1. Sources of Disputes in Agarwood

Common challenges that lead to disputes include:

  • Mislabeling or substitution of batches
  • Disagreement over chip/resin grade or weight
  • Late or incomplete payments
  • Unclear ownership or revenue-sharing terms
  • Non-compliance with legal or export regulations

2. How Transparency Prevents Disputes

Transparency ensures all parties can see, verify, and confirm every step:

  • Tree-level traceability: Each tree has a unique UTID
  • Batch-level traceability: Chips/resin grouped with batch IDs
  • Event logging: Inoculation, harvest, processing, and packaging recorded
  • On-chain verification: Immutable blockchain records for all milestones
  • Digital certificates: Buyers and regulators can confirm origin, grade, and compliance

4. Key Practices for Dispute Prevention

  1. Record Everything: All tree IDs, batch IDs, weights, grades, and harvest events.
  2. Link to Blockchain: Ensure all records are immutable and timestamped.
  3. Use Smart Contracts: Payments and revenue share are automatically triggered based on verified milestones.
  4. Batch Integrity: Maintain separate, labeled batches to avoid mixing or substitution.
  5. Open Access: Provide buyers, investors, and regulators access to verified records via QR or blockchain portal.
  6. Digital Audit Trails: Keep a complete, auditable history of every event in the supply chain.

5. Benefits of Transparency

  • Reduces Fraud & Mislabeling: Buyers can verify grade and origin
  • Prevents Payment Disputes: SmartAgri Contracts automate payouts
  • Enhances Buyer Confidence: Traceable, verifiable products command premium prices
  • Strengthens Compliance: Supports CITES, DENR, and export regulations
  • Builds Cooperative Trust: Shared visibility of all activities reduces internal conflicts
